COMMERCIAL.

New Zealand Herald Office. Wednesday evening. The Customs duties to-day amounted to £976 16s lid. The sale of Dargaville township allotments was held to-day by Messrs. Digby Tonks and Co., at the Brunswick Mart, The attendance was large, consisting mainly of residents and settlers in and about Dargaville, and it was apparent that several present held commissions to purchase several of the sections. Some 34 lots were disposed of at prices varying from £28 to £s2 per acre, and subsequent to the sale several lota wero selected and purchased at prices slightly in advance of auction values. Much confidence is expressed in the ultimate future of this township, surrounded, as it is, by a prosperous ana thriving district. The bankrupt stocks in the houses of business of Messrs. Garrett Brothers, situated at Queen-street, Karangahaj>e Road, and Gisborne, were sold by Mr. Gabriel Lewis to-day. These stocks were valued respectively at £1719 Is. £753 Ss lid, and ±.'426 10s 2d, the valuation being based on the retail sale price. The Queen-street stock was bought by Mr. Davis at lis 6d in the £; the Karangahape Road stock, by Mr. Leys, at l"2s 3d ; and the Gisborne stock, also by Mr. Leys, at lis in the £. The prices are considered by the Official Assignee to be eminently satisfactory, and are an indication that better times are coming, if not already upon us.
